- The distance between Honolulu, Oahu, Hawaii and Ifrane, Morocco is approximately 13,267 km or 8,245 mi.
- To reach Honolulu, Oahu in this distance one would set out from Ifrane bearing 330.7°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Honolulu, Oahu bearing 206° or SSW .
- Honolulu, Oahu has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ry summers (As) whereas Ifrane has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- The average temperature is 13.7 °C (24.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12.6 °C (22.7°F) less in Honolulu, Oahu.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 559.1 mm (22 in) less which is equivalent to 559.1 l/m² (13.72 US gal/ft²) or 5,591,000 l/ha (597,715 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.7° higher in Honolulu, Oahu than in Ifrane.
